Notes

Used about 16 grams of worsted-weight yarn for the sweater, and just a tiny amount of the white yarn for the mittens. It took about 2 hours to do the knitting.

I did one less row of ribbing at the top, so that the top edge of the sweater wouldn’t interfere with drinking.

Just need to get the hooks to put on the mittens.

The worsted-weight yarn worked out fine, but I think I might add 2 stitches next time. To fit some of my larger mugs, I’d probably have to add 4 stitches.

Next time: Instead of putting the second sleeve directly opposite the first one, I would set it a few rows towards the back, to match where the one next to the handle sits.

I’d also consider making it so that the handle is on the left as you look at it (for right-handed people), so that the arms aren’t in the way as you drink from the mug. But of course, that means the cute side would face away from you as you use it.

The mittens just happen to be exactly the right size for a Barbie doll.
